  • On June 22, 1996, a man opened the doors to the evolution of wrestling we have all grown to know and love. On that night, the Electronic Universal Wrestling Corporation began. The EUWC was ridden with success right off the bat. Matt Pickstock signed top superstars like STEALTH, X.Plosion, and The Black Panthers. The EUWC ran under Matt Pickstock for years. This is the man who brought us Monday Night Brawl, Friday Fray, Wednesday Night Havoc n Hell, Saturday Night Super Clash, EUWC Extreme and Main Frame! Matt saw money in the great Apocalypse vs Badd Company feud which was headlined by Don Hall battling STEALTH in a covered steel cage. Thanks to Pickstock's brilliant business talents, the EUWC worked a long partnership with the Cyber Federation of Professional Wrestling (CFPW) and the Limestone City Wrestling (LCW). These two partnerships culminated in three separate cross federation PPVs. The first came in February of 1997 as the EUWC vs CFPW presented When World's Collide! Then in August of 1997, the EUWC vs LCW presented Net Wars 1997! And finally the three were brought together in February of 1998 with EUWC vs CFPW vs LCW: When World's Collide... AGAIN! On all three occasions the EUWC came out on top with the majority of victories. In 2001, Matt purchased the Aftershock International Wrestling Organization and joined it with the EUWC. After months of fierce battles between EUWC and AIWO superstars, Matt purchased the CFPW World Championship and created a gigantic Unification Match between AIWO, CFPW and the EUWC World Heavyweight Champion. In 2002, Matt came into financial difficulties, forcing the EUWC to be put up for sale. Nearly a year later, Keith Jackson purchased the EUWC and hired Pickstock as the Commissioner of the EUWC. Currently using his Commissioner power to help him and his Regime stable, Pickstock is still a big part of the EUWC. In the future, as superstars come and go, one thing remains the same... Matt Pickstock will always be a part of the EUWC.
